Abstract

The present invention relates to a polyurea system encompassing as component A) isocyanate-functional prepolymers obtainable by reaction of aliphatic isocyanates A1) with polyols A2), which can in particular have a number average molecular weight of ≧400 g/mol and an average OH functionality of 2 to 6, as component B) amino-functional compounds of general formula (I) in which X is an organic residue comprising a tertiary amino function, having no Zerewitinoff active hydrogen, R1 is a CH2—COOR3 residue, in which R3 is an organic residue having no Zerewitinoff active hydrogen, a linear or branched C1 to C4 alkyl residue, a cyclopentyl or cyclohexyl residue or H, R2 is an organic residue having no Zerewitinoff active hydrogen, n is an integer ≧2 or ≦3, in particular for closing, binding, bonding or covering cell tissue, and to a metering system for the polyurea system according to the invention.
